"Ciao L.A." is a 6.5-minute comedy video from over 20 years ago and basically a little add-on to the Beastie Boys's song and music video "Sabotage". The characters from the video (i.e. the Beastie Boys in costume) show up in a talk show and are interviewed by the two female hosts. One of them is Sofia Coppola (love her "Lost in Translation"), at this point not yet the wife of Spike Jonze, who directed the music video I mentioned earlier as well as this little video here. There is a touch of Jerry Springer to it at times, but sadly, all in all I did not find this one as funny and entertaining as I hoped. Interesting watch for the prominent cast, but not really for the contents. Thumbs down.
